Transaction 3548636fc12efc2dc50c102fe4047a9fd4435d68f172eb797b59e47ffbd9c79f

1 Input
2 Outputs
  • 3548636fc12efc2dc50c102fe4047a9fd4435d68f172eb797b59e47ffbd9c79f:0
  • value  5331726
    address  3EDumd3qdVrzqLJDZUrW8hgNLf7PEzL1Zk
  • 3548636fc12efc2dc50c102fe4047a9fd4435d68f172eb797b59e47ffbd9c79f:1
  • value  148764884
    address  3HVn6LtjLUCTEk6EfG9sCzJD6B9W3xkMqi